Clinical Trial Summary

This is a single-center study intended to evaluate prealbumin (transthyretin), a marker of anabolic metabolism, in men with androgen deficiency (Low-T). There is emerging evidence that prealbumin is an indicator of anabolic, versus catabolic, metabolism, and that lower levels may be associated with hypogonadism.
